Search for one job title and you reach only the people who happen to use that exact label, which for most roles is a minority of the qualified market. Employers name the same work differently, candidates describe themselves in their last employer’s vocabulary, and titles lag the actual job by a year or more. The fix is to source against a map instead of a keyword: the cluster of alternative titles for the role plus the skills that reliably travel with it. This post builds that map for one role, site reliability engineer, then gives you the method to build it for any role.
Why does one job title miss most of the market?
Job titles are set by employers, not by a standards body. The same person, same laptop, same pager, can be a DevOps engineer at a 40-person startup, get relabeled site reliability engineer after a new VP arrives, and end up platform engineer when the team splits in two. None of those renames changed what they can do for you.
Candidates compound the problem. Profiles get updated late or not at all, people keep the title of their best-sounding past job, and plenty of strong engineers describe themselves in their team’s internal vocabulary rather than anything a recruiter would type. Meanwhile every recruiter searching the exact title converges on the same overexposed slice of the market: people who adopted the fashionable label and keep their profiles polished, which correlates strongly with already being flooded with recruiter messages.
The deeper pool, people doing the work under a different name and not thinking about recruiters at all, only becomes visible when you search for the work itself. That means alternative titles and, more importantly, skills.
A worked example: mapping the SRE role
Suppose the brief is a site reliability engineer. Searching that title alone gets you the people who currently call themselves SREs. Here is who it misses:
| Adjacent title | How it relates to SRE | What to verify before outreach |
|---|---|---|
| DevOps engineer | The most common alternative label; near-identical work at smaller companies | That the role includes production ownership, not only CI/CD pipelines |
| Platform engineer | Builds the internal platform SREs run; heavy tooling overlap | Whether they carry on-call and operate what they build |
| Production engineer | The same job under a different name at a handful of large tech companies | Mostly scale and seniority; the work itself usually maps one to one |
| Infrastructure engineer | Broad label covering cloud, networking and sometimes rebranded sysadmin work | Depth on Kubernetes and infrastructure as code, not ticket-driven ops |
Then the skill layer. Four signals travel with this role almost everywhere:
- Kubernetes (often written K8s) for running production workloads
- Terraform, or infrastructure as code generally, for provisioning
- An observability stack: Prometheus, Grafana, Datadog or similar
- On-call and incident response, the clearest marker that someone operates systems rather than only building them
A skill-led search such as (Kubernetes OR K8s) AND (Terraform OR “infrastructure as code”) AND (“on-call” OR SLO OR incident) finds the platform engineer who is functionally an SRE and has never used the title. How do you build this map for any role?
The SRE example generalizes into a five-step method. Budget about an hour per role; the map gets reused in every search, message and screen afterwards.
- Start from known-good people, not keywords. Collect three to five profiles everyone agrees are strong: current team members, the best past hire, the person the hiring manager wishes they could clone. These are your ground truth.
- Harvest their titles, current and previous. The previous titles matter most. They show what this kind of person was called two jobs ago, which is exactly what the hidden part of the market still calls itself.
- Harvest recurring skills, then split anchors from decoration. List every tool and responsibility that appears on most of the ground-truth profiles. Some are anchors (Kubernetes, for an SRE), some are decoration that appears on every profile and filters nothing. The discipline for separating them is the same one we use for requirements in must-have versus nice-to-have skills.
- Mine other companies’ job ads. Read five postings from companies hiring the same role. Their titles and requirement lists tell you what the market calls this work right now, including labels you would not have guessed.
- Turn the map into searches, and run them in more than one place. Title-led strings for precision, skill-led strings for coverage. What goes wrong when you widen the net?
Two failure modes, both manageable.
First, noise. A wider net pulls in platform engineers who have never carried a pager and infrastructure engineers who are sysadmins with a new headline. The map has to cut both ways: adjacent titles get people into the pool, then anchor skills plus one role-defining signal (for SRE, on-call ownership) decide who stays. This is also where scoring people against the actual job description beats scanning titles by eye, and it is worth understanding how candidate matching works before trusting any tool to do it for you.
Second, seniority drift. Adjacent titles do not carry consistent seniority: a senior DevOps engineer at a 30-person company and a mid-level SRE at a large platform business may have swapped scopes entirely. Calibrate on what they ran, what broke, and what they owned, not on years spent under a particular label.

Frequently asked questions
Why does searching one job title miss so many candidates?
Because employers name the same work differently and candidates describe themselves in their last employer's vocabulary. A site reliability engineer at one company is a DevOps engineer or platform engineer at the next, doing a near-identical job. A single-title search only reaches people who happen to use that exact label, and it overweights candidates who actively optimize their profiles for recruiter search. Searching adjacent titles and skills reaches the rest.
Which job titles are adjacent to site reliability engineer?
The usual cluster is DevOps engineer, platform engineer, production engineer and infrastructure engineer, with cloud engineer as a frequent borderline case. The titles overlap heavily but are not interchangeable: a platform engineer may build internal tooling without carrying a pager, and infrastructure engineer can describe anything from a Kubernetes specialist to a rebranded sysadmin. Confirm the work behind the label, especially on-call ownership, before treating someone as an SRE candidate.
How do I find adjacent skills for a role I do not know well?
Start from people instead of keywords. Take three to five profiles everyone agrees are strong, current team members or respected past hires, and list every tool and responsibility that appears on most of them. Then read five job ads from other companies hiring the same role and note which requirements recur. The overlap of those two lists is your adjacent-skill set; ask the hiring manager to mark which of them are genuine anchors.
Should recruiters search by job title or by skills?
Both, in different ratios depending on the role. Titles give precision and are quick to scan, so they work as a first pass. Skills give coverage: they catch the platform engineer who is functionally an SRE and the candidate whose title has not caught up with their work. In practice, run title-led and skill-led searches separately, compare the result sets, and let the differences teach you which labels your market actually uses.
